There is a charming fishing village in the South of France called Cassis. It is famous for its local dry white wine, rocky inlets and breath-taking views over the seaside cliffs. The cliffs of Cap Canaille where the photo was taken are among the highest maritime cliffs in Europe. It is a paradise for hicking, climbing, sailing, scuba diving and cycling.
